Bogidiellapingxiangensis, a new species of subterranean Amphipoda from southern China (Bogidiellidae).


ABSTRACT: A new species of subterranean amphipod, Bogidiellapingxiangensis Hou & Li, sp. n., is described from Xiongshizilong Cave in Pingxiang City, China. The new species is characterized by having the bases of pereopods III and V expanded; the inner ramus of pleopods I-III with one segment; the telson longer than wide and with the apical margin with a shallow U-shaped excavation. DNA barcode of the new species is documented as support of molecular differences between related species.
